A Printed Circuit Board is a thing board used for electronic appliances. PCP appliances are connected using copper tracks instead of wires. These PCBs are then used in varied streams like computers, cell phones, electronics, and other electronics.Printed circuit boards are components that are made up of one or more layers including with electrical components. Printed Circuit Boards are then welded to secure them in place and the copper traces connect them forming a circuit. The appliances and PCB board together are called PCB Assembly or (Printed Circuit Assembly). A printed circuit board is an insulation piece which is threaded with wires and similar components. When a power source supply to the plate, it is distributed through these wires to the various electronic appliances in a variety of ways. This allows the PCB board control how these electronic components are charged and activated during for the use of an electrical device. A variety of devices include at least one PCB, including computers, mobile phones, and digital watches.

The sleeker and smaller printed circuit boards use signal traces or conductive tracks made of copper and support mechanically the electronic appliances product. How Is A Printed Circuit Board Made? The insulating board in a Printed Circuit Board is made of different types of materials. The use of different types of materials helps to boost the insulating property of the Printed Circuit Board and helps the circuit board to be better grounded.

The circuit board is normally coated with a solder mask and solder mask usually white, red, green, black, white, or blue, is painted over the circuit board for insulation purposes. There are quite a variety of dielectrics that can be chosen to provide few different insulating values and it depends on the requirements of the PCBs circuit. The PCBs is generally designed using CAD software. The used materials in the making of PCBs are commonly Nelco, Polyimide, FR4, FR4 High Temperature, Rogers, FR1, Bakelite, GeTek, Arlon, Alumina, Ceramic, CEM1 and CEM5. The requirement of the PCBs determines the thickness and dimension of the Printed Circuit Boards.

These days, just about every electronic component in your home contains a PCB of some type: printers, televisions, computers, microwave ovens, musical instrument amplifiers, digital clocks, stereos, telephone and even mobile phones. The testing of Printed Circuit Boards is done to be sure the board works inerrably. The two major flaws a Printed Circuit Board faces are shorts and open. PCBs Circuit Manufacturers should ensure that accurate PCB testing is carried out before the Printed Circuit Board is assembled.
